ID:409128

Qwakshfne=

JAVA开发

  • 公司信息:
  • 贵州多彩宝互联网服务有限公司
  • 工作经验:
  • 3年
  • 兼职日薪:
  • 500元/8小时
  • 兼职时间:
  • 下班后
  • 周六
  • 周日
  • 可工作日远程
  • 可工作日驻场(离职原因)
  • 可工作日驻场(自由职业原因)
  • 所在区域:
  • 贵阳
  • 全区

技术能力

Spring生态系统(Java)
•基于Spring Boot和Spring Cloud构建可扩展应用程序的全面知识。
•灵活运用SpringWebFlux的非阻塞响应式编程。
•项目改造集成SpringAI
熟悉Spring JPA和Hibernate作为ORM。经验也包括MyBatis。

数据库和中间件
•能够使用MySQL等关系型数据库进行查询性能优化。
•熟悉MongoDB、Elasticsearch等NoSQL数据库。
•了解Hive和Impala等数据仓库。
•精通QueryDsl和Blaze Persistence处理复杂数据流。
•Rabbit MQ消息推送。
•Redis缓存解决方案。
•熟悉Zookeeper分布式配置编排。
•Nacos用于管理微服务发现和云配置。

前端框架
•熟练使用JavaScript框架React,Next.js和Vue.js(包括vue和Vue.js)
用于开发响应式web应用程序。
•熟悉TypeScript增强的类型安全特性。
•Tailwind CSS等现代CSS框架

DevOps和容器
•能够部署和配置Kubernetes与Rancher一起用于集群管理。
熟练使用Docker作为集装箱化工具。
•利用Harbor作为集群映像仓库和注册表。
•熟悉Nginx的web服务器和反向代理设置。

构建和CI/CD工具
•熟练使用Gradle、Maven等依赖管理工具。
•熟悉包管理工具,包括npm和nvm下node.js的环境。
•有使用Jenkins进行阶段构建和集成部署的经验。

版本控制和团队合作
•熟练使用Git进行版本控制,实现软件协同开发和有效的代码管理。
•使用Sonatype Nexus进行工件管理。
•使用敏捷方法从事基于团队的开发实践。

项目经验

公司内部全链路监控平台:负责主导开发基于 KLE(Kibana + Logstash + Elasticsearch)的分布式日志聚合与检索体系,集成 SkyWalking 做分布式链路追踪;实现日志采集、索引策略与 ILM(索引生命周期管理),通过 Logstash 管道与 Filebeat/Fluentd 采集多源日志,Elasticsearch 负责高可用存储与检索,Kibana 提供可视化告警面板;基于 XXL-JOB 调度引擎实现业务条件触发的告警规则与报警策略,支持阈值、频次与多维度条件组合,包含告警去重、分级与通知(邮件/钉钉/短信)机制。

CRM SaaS:作为后端负责人构建可扩展微服务架构,服务间采用 Spring Boot + Spring Cloud(或自研服务注册/网关)通信,使用 Apache Seata 实现分布式全局事务(AT/TC 模式)以保证跨服务一致性;设计并实现基于自定义注解与 Spring AOP 的动态实体属性体系,支持类型安全的序列化、按需索引与灵活查询(例如 JSONB/动态列映射),并在持久层通过 MyBatis / JPA 优化 SQL 与分表策略以支撑高并发与海量数据(公司内部项目)。

Protobuf WebSocket IMS:后端实现用于即时消息与事件推送的网关,使用 Protobuf 定义消息协议以减小序列化体积并保证跨语言兼容性,通过 Netty/Tomcat 的 WebSocket 支持多连接长链路;在多实例部署下实现会话路由与负载均衡(基于 Nginx 或自研路由层),实现消息确认、重试与顺序保证策略,并支持水平扩缩容与连接降级策略以保障高可用性。

数据分析平台:参与后端与 SDK 开发,搭建用户行为埋点、事件收集与 ETL 流程,使用 Kafka/Flume 做消息队列,Flink/Spark 做流批处理与实时计算,结果存储到 ClickHouse/Elasticsearch 供分析与 BI 展示;开发面向移动与 Web 的埋点 SDK(支持离线缓存、批量上报、事件加密与版本兼容),并提供多维漏斗、留存与转化率分析模块,支持自定义指标与可视化报表(项目链接见原文)。

Mirai-AI Tencent QQ Chatbot:个人项目,使用 Kotlin 与 Mirai 框架接入 QQ 协议,结合自然语言处理(分词、意图识别、槽位抽取)实现对话流程管理;集成外部 AI/NLP 服务用于问答与意图推断,支持会话上下文管理、多轮对话与命令式插件扩展,部署考虑消息并发、限流与错峰处理。

Selenium with Wolfram Alpha and Chrome Plugin:开发浏览器扩展(基于 Vue3)与后端自动化抓取模块,利用 Selenium 驱动无头浏览器自动提交数学问题到 Wolfram Alpha 并解析返回结果,浏览器插件负责捕获页面问题并与后端交互,支持结果高亮、步骤展示与缓存策略以降低请求频率。

DeFi Onion Website:个人 Web3 项目,使用 Solidity 编写智能合约并在 Tron 区块链上部署,前端使用 React 与 TronWeb SDK / TronLink 钱包集成;智能合约包括代币交互、流动性池或简单的合约逻辑,考虑过安全性检测(重入、溢出检查)、交易鉴权与前端签名流程,支持基本的测试与部署流水线。

案例展示

  • 某web3隐私通信案例

    某web3隐私通信案例

    一套面向隐私保护的 Web3 私密聊天交易平台,结合 onion 路由隐私技术提供端到端加密通信、链上/链下交易通道与严格的匿名性保护,适用于去中心化社交与点对点资产交换场景。 负责整体架构设计与核心后端实现,技术栈包括 Next.js 前端、Spring Boot 后端、 T

  • WolframAlpha自动化爬虫

    WolframAlpha自动化爬虫

    纯个人兴趣开发的小工具,一个 Chrome/Edge 插件与后端 Selenium 自动化爬虫,自动登录 WolframAlpha 并抓取问答内容,通过 iframe 将完整的提问与答案嵌入插件界面以实现无缝展示与交互。这里主要用作技术展示 使用 Vite 构建的 Vue3(C

查看案例列表(含更多 0 个案例)

信用行为

  • 接单
    0
  • 评价
    0
  • 收藏
    0
微信扫码,建群沟通

发布任务

企业点击发布任务,工程师会在任务下报名,招聘专员也会在1小时内与您联系,1小时内精准确定人才

微信接收人才推送

关注猿急送微信平台,接收实时人才推送

接收人才推送
联系需求方端客服
联系需求方端客服